January 13, 1998Piccolo snare drums continue to increase in popularity both as a main snare or a subsnare addition to
the basic kit. With their new PST1233 (3 1/4" x 12") and PST1255 (5 1/2" x 12") piccolo snare drum
listing for a paltry $179.99, Tama now has one of the widest ranges of piccolos available--both in
numbers of models and different prices. On the other end of the scale, Tama continues to offer its
famous (or infamously loud) Bell Brass PL5325 (3 1/4" x 14") piccolo which, at $1299.99, costs as much
as many full sets of drums.
Right in the middle is Tama's bronze piccolo, one of the new favorites of many drummers. "Bronze has a
very pleasing tone all it's own--between wood and metal-which gives a good balance for a piccolo,"
commented Bill Reim, Tama's Art and Advertising manager, and a drummer himself. "We've had a lot of
drummers tells us that our bronze snare drums, both piccolos and regular sizes are now their favorite
